Palliative Care Conversations for Heart Failure Nurses: A Pilot Education Intervention

Introduction Heart failure is a progressive condition affecting 6.2 million Americans. The use of palliative and supportive care for symptom management and improved quality of life is recommended for persons with heart failure.
